Cost to Own a Home in Belmond, Iowa

A $111,000 home here costs

$1,054

per month, all in — with 20% down at today's 6.66% 30-year fixed rate.

A standard mortgage calculator would have told you $571. The real number is $484 higher every month — 85% more than the payment most buyers budget for.

Where every dollar goes

Only the first line is a mortgage payment. Change any assumption above and every figure below recalculates.

Principal & interest30-year fixed, $88,800 borrowed $571
Property tax1.597% effective rate for Belmond itself $148
Homeowners insuranceIowa averages $1,043/yr (NAIC), or 0.522% of home value $48
Electricity14.14¢/kWh — Iowa residential average, EIA $127
Water, sewer & trashUS household average $68
Maintenance reserve1% of home value per year $93
Total monthly $1,054

The weather behind that power bill

Belmond sits in Wright County, which averages a high of 85.0°F in its hottest month and a low of 6.2°F in its coldest, with 34.27" of precipitation a year and 43% of it in a single three-month stretch. That climate drives 804 cooling and 7,309 heating degree days, which is what sets the $127 electricity line above.

Common questions

How much does it cost to own a home in Belmond?

A $111,000 home in Belmond, Iowa costs approximately $1,054 per month with 20% down at 6.66%. That is $571 principal and interest, $148 property tax, $48 homeowners insurance, $195 utilities and $93 set aside for maintenance.

What is the property tax rate in Belmond?

Belmond has an effective property tax rate of 1.597%, based on a median home value of $110,800 and median real estate taxes of $1,770. That is higher than the Wright County average of 1.544%.

What is the average home price in Belmond?

The median owner-occupied home value in Belmond, Iowa is $110,800, against $109,800 across Wright County.

Is it cheaper to rent or buy in Belmond?

Median gross rent in Belmond is $820 a month, against $1,054 to own the median home all in. Renting costs less month to month here, though renting builds no equity.
